9. Research on amine-based carbon dioxide (CO2) capture has mainly focused on improving the effectiveness and efficiency of the CO2 capture process. Researchers at the University of Regina undertook a study to examine factors that impact efficiency of this chemical process. Their outcome variable of interest was percentage of transformed CO2, and the dependent variable was temperature. At each of four temperatures (10C, 15C, 20C, 25C) eight trials were performed. The 32 percentage transformed CO2 values are tabulated below Temperature (degrees Celsius)Percentage transformed CO2 10 15 20 25 71.23 73.42 80.36 84.96 (a) What are three assumptions of ANOVA? (b) How would you graphically assess those assumptions that can be graphically assessed? Give names of specific plots that you would use and state which assumption each plot assesses (c) What are the null and alternative hypotheses in this study? (d) Complete the ANOVA table.
